Match List I with List II
| LIST I | LIST II |
| A. \(\frac{d y}{d x}=e^{x-y}+x^2 e^{-y}\) | I. Linear Differential Equation of type \(\frac{d y}{d x}+P y=Q\) |
| B. \(\frac{d y}{d x}-2 y=\cos 3 x\) | II. Homogeneous Differential Equation |
| C. \(x^2 \frac{d y}{d x}=x^2-2 y^2+x y\) | III. Linear Differential Equation of type \(\frac{d x}{d y}+P x=Q\) |
| D. \(\left(x+2 y^3\right) \frac{d y}{d x}=y\) | IV. Variable separable |
- A A-II, B-III, C-IV, D-I
- B A-IV, B-III, C-II, D-I
- C A-IV, B-I, C-II, D-III
- D A-III, B-I, C-IV, D-II
Answer & Solution
Correct Answer
(C) A-IV, B-I, C-II, D-III
Step-by-step Solution
Detailed explanation
A. \(\frac{d y}{d x}=e^{x-y}+x^2 e^{-y} \Rightarrow \frac{d y}{d x}=e^{-y}(e^x+x^2) \Rightarrow e^y dy=(e^x+x^2)dx \). This is variable separable. B. \(\frac{d y}{d x}-2 y=\cos 3 x \). This is of the form \(\frac{d y}{d x}+P y=Q\). C.…

Proteins are the polymers of about twenty different a-amino acids which are linked by peptide bonds. Proteins perform various structural and dynamic functions in the organisms. Proteins which contain only a-amino acids are called simple proteins. The secondary or tertiary structure of proteins get disturbed on change of pH or temperature and they are not able to perform their functions. This is called denaturation of proteins. Enzymes are biocatalysts which speed up the reactions in biosystems. Vitamins are accessory food factors required in the diet. They are classified as fat soluble (A, D, E and K) and water soluble (B group and C). Deficiency of vitamins leads to many diseases. Nucleic acids are the polymers of nucleotides which in turn consist of a base, a pentose sugar and phosphate moiety. Nucleic acids are responsible for the transfer of characters from parents to offsprings. There are two types of nucleic acids DNA and RNA. DNA contains a five carbon sugar molecule called 2-deoxyribose whereas RNA contains ribose.
